K Naganuma is a scholar working on Hematology, Physiology and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, K Naganuma has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 354 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Hematology, 3 papers in Physiology and 3 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in K Naganuma’s work include Erythrocyte Function and Pathophysiology (3 papers), Erythropoietin and Anemia Treatment (3 papers) and Mast cells and histamine (2 papers). K Naganuma is often cited by papers focused on Erythrocyte Function and Pathophysiology (3 papers), Erythropoietin and Anemia Treatment (3 papers) and Mast cells and histamine (2 papers). K Naganuma collaborates with scholars based in Japan and United Kingdom. K Naganuma's co-authors include K Koike, M Takagi, Akira Ishiguro, T Kikuchi and Kohichiro Tsuji and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Experimental Medicine, Blood and The Journal of Immunology.
